Marcos signs order for an 'integrated system' in public transactions

PRESIDENT Ferdinand 'Bongbong' Marcos Jr. has issued an executive order enjoining all government offices and local government units to adopt and implement an integrated financial management information system (IFMIS) in their transactions with the general public, Malacañang said on Friday.

Signed on June 1, 2023, EO 29 -- 'Strengthening the Integration of Public Financial Management Information Systems, Streamlining Processes Thereof, and Amending Executive Order 55 (S. 2011) for the Purpose' -- is in line with the Marcos administration's commitment to improve bureaucratic efficiency by capitalizing on digitization efforts to ensure fast and efficient delivery of services to the public, according to the Presidential Communications Office (PCO).
